On Fri, 24 Jan 2014, Krzysztof Kozlowski wrote:
> Add support for GPIO control (enable/disable) over Buck9. The Buck9
> Converter is used as a supply for eMMC Host Controller.
>
> BUCK9EN GPIO of S5M8767 chip may be used by application processor to
> enable or disable the Buck9. This has two benefits:
> - It is faster than toggling it over I2C bus.
> - It allows disabling the regulator during suspend to RAM; The AP will
> enable it during resume; Without the patch the regulator supplying
> eMMC must be defined as fixed-regulator.
